TAS Welcomes 27 New Students in Semester 2 of the 2025–26 School Year

On Monday, January 5, Taipei American School welcomed the families of 27 new students to the Semester 2 New Family Orientation.  

At TAS, we’re committed to a mission-aligned Admissions process, from a family’s first questions about our school, to their child’s first day on campus. At New Family Orientation, this means we’re focused on helping students and parents feel prepared, excited, and supported as they officially begin their TAS journey.

Joining TAS from schools both in Taiwan and abroad, the newest members of our Tiger family were greeted by student ambassadors and administrators alike in welcome sessions hosted by each division. By taking the time to connect, our students and administrators alike are planting the seeds of connection. It’s important to us that all of our new students have a positive peer relationship from their very first day on campus and recognize their divisional administrators as friendly faces that they can trust.  

From there, opportunities to connect with counselors and classroom teachers occupied the new students’ time, while their parents learned more about the rhythms of school life, and what to expect over the next semester.  

“New Family Orientation is an important touchstone in every family’s TAS journey,” comments Michael O'Neill, Director of Admissions. “We do our best to make this big, vibrant community feel instantly accessible, so that new students and parents alike understand that they belong from day one.

Families reunited in the Legacy Commons for the New Family School Fair, where they met with representatives from key school services like Security, IT, and Transportation, and connected with teams like Communications, TYPA, and the PTA, on the many ways to enhance their Tiger experience.  

With their IDs printed, PowerSchool credentials complete, and a rundown of the activities, offerings, and opportunities available in our community, our new families left campus ready to start the semester strong!
